Disable SweetFX for better AMS performance on a weak PC

TL;DR Have a weak PC? Struggling with FPS with AMS1? Disable SweetFX.

The title pretty much says it all. AMS1 is a great sim to use on a weak PC and still be able to get a decent looking sim with an overall great driving experience.

But I was AMAZED at how much smoother my experience was and how much higher my FPS got on my potato computer by fully disabling SweetFX in the configuration tool for the game. For me, it was the difference maker allowing steady, smooth FPS, even with 20+ AI on track with me.

Just a little tip. I know it's kinda obvious to anyone experienced with these things... but sometimes it's good to share such things anyway. Hopefully it'll be useful to someone someday!
